Slovenia's Digital Ambition: A Double-Edged Sword
Slovenia has announced a significant leap into the digital realm with plans to build a new supercomputer and an artificial intelligence (AI) factory. This initiative, as highlighted by the Slovenian government, aims to bolster the country's technological prowess and foster innovation within the AI sector. However, while the potential for growth and advancement is substantial, the path is fraught with challenges that require careful navigation.
